Rs800,000 relief package announced for flood-hit families
Financial compensation for families of flood victims

Lahore: Punjab Chief Minister Chudhary Pervaiz Elahi Monday announced financial assistance of RS800,000 for family of each deceased in flood-hit areas of Rajanpur, Muzaffargarh, Muzaffargarh and Mianwali.
The Chief Minister stated this while chairing a meeting in provincial capital.
The meeting reviewed the relief activities in flood hit areas.
Addressing the meeting, Elahi directed all relevant departments to speed up relief activities in integrated manner.
He also directed elected representatives, Commissioners and Deputy Commissioners to monitor relief activities and present the report. He also directed to help the affectees after the estimation of loss of cattle, crops and houses.
Pervaiz Elahi also ordered to establish medical camps in flood-hit areas and vaccinate the people of contiguous diseases.
